SECTION 4 -13, 110-2" Planned Shopping Center District, contd. Page 2 <br />48• 13. ISSUANCE OF BUILDING PERMIT. No building permit shall be issued unless the <br />49. development plans aid &uppertl -ag data lease has been given final approval by the <br />50. Commission and such approval marked or stamped on said plans with the Commission's <br />51. seal of approval. <br />52. <br />53. 14. REVOCATION OF BUILDING PERMIT. Any person who fails to commence construction of <br />54. the Shopping Center within twenty -four (24) months after the date of final <br />55. approval of the development plan or who fails to carry to completion 100 per cent <br />56. (100 %) of the development plan within three (3) years after said final approval <br />57. or within two (2) years after construction is begun, whichever is later, or who <br />58. fails to conform to the provisions of the final development plan and sxppeptlag <br />59• daaa shall be required by the Commission to show cause at a public hearing, duly <br />60. advertised in accordance with SECTION 23 of Ordinance No. 3702, why such approval <br />61. should not be withdrawn and any building permit revoked. <br />62. <br />63• 15. CERTIFICATE OF OCCUPANCY. It shall be unlawful to use or permit the use of any <br />64. building or premises or part thereof, hereafter created, erected, changed, <br />66. converted, moved, altered or enlarged, wholly, or partly in its use or structure, <br />99 : converted, <br />a Certificate of Occupancy shall have been issued therefor by the Building <br />67. Commissioner. No Certificate of Occupancy shall be issued permitting the use of <br />68. a "C -2" District unless and until the development plan, as approved and stamped <br />69. by the City Planning Commission, has been fully and finally accomplished and <br />70. completed :�n aeeo-Fdaaee with saekr apppgved € }ter'= Bevel epmeatr glas. <br />71. <br />74. 16. AMENDMENTS TO DEVELOPMENT PLANS. The developer of a Planned Shopping Center in <br />73. any "C -211 District shall submit a written request to the Commission for any <br />74. change, alteration, amendment, or extension to the pipellm}nafy eP €ice develop - <br />75• ment plan. If, in the opinion of the Commission, the requested change is <br />76. sufficiently substantial to so warrant, the Commission will hold a public hearing <br />77• as prescribed under SECTION 23, above. If the Commission approves such change, <br />78. it will notify the Building Commissioner who shall issue a building permit <br />79. accordingly. <br />10 1056 <br />FREDA G.
